What Does Stacking Mean?

When more than one anabolic-androgenic steroid (or any other performance-enhancing compound) is used at the same time, it's called stacking.

One compound can be felt to have a certain profile of effects; another, a different one. For this reason, bodybuilders strive to use compounds they believe work well together.

In bodybuilding, for instance, these compounds are typically linked to muscle growth, or they're known to be better for strength, for maintaining muscle throughout a Fat Loss program, or for giving a harder look. The significance is that these are not proven within bodybuilding science, but are role-playing applied concepts in the way of bodybuilding.

The Major Problem With Multiple Compounds

The disadvantage of stacking is that it's quite tricky to know what effects you are actually getting. It is easy to see a relationship if an athlete takes one compound to see one thing happen for them. If more than one compound is added simultaneously, it is difficult to see what picture or imprint is being formed.

Changes, for better or worse, make it more difficult to decide on them. This is particularly important if athletes are modifying according to anecdotal reports. A successful development for a bodybuilder may be attributed to a single compound, but it is actually determined by the mix of compounds, training system, nutrition, and genetic factors.

Does Stacking Actually Work Better?

Well, yes, stacking can yield other effects simply because each compound has a pharmacological action, but not necessarily a uniquely predictable synergy. Many factors will determine the effectiveness of a combination, such as the individual, the products' content, and the amount of exposure.

It is known that anabolic steroids can enhance muscle protein synthesis, build muscle mass, and increase strength. It's less clear how much extra will come from a sequential treatment of various and alternate anabolic & androgenic steroids. In such bodybuilding forums, there is a tendency to ignore this distinction.
